after using vim in an xterm to edit some bigger files, I often get the
feeling of being "lost" in the file after a while, i.e. I don't feel in
touch with my current position in the file. Of course, line numbers and
the percentage of where I am are displayed, but still. I then recently,
while using gvim again, realized that the reason for my weird feeling is
that there's no scroll bar in the xterm mode. It seems that it makes a
big difference for me psychologically to have a visual representation of
where I am in the file, as opposed to just seeing the line
number/percentage, which gives me the information, but in an abstract
way. So, I was wondering if there's a way to get a scroll bar in the
non-gui version of vim as well. Maybe it's a capability that I haven't
found yet? It also seems feasible that this is something that an
extension script could do. Maybe something like that exists (didn't find
anything on the website). I'm not necessarily looking for something that
I can drag to change position, just really a visual representation of
where I am in the file proportionally. Does anyone know of anything like
that?

AFAIK, scrollbars are set by flags of the 'guioptions' setting, which is
only available in GUI mode (the help says "if compiled with GUI enabled"
but I just ran a short test which showed that it doesn't work in Console
mode, even if compiled with GUI enabled).
So, the short answer would be: No, you can't do it.
A slightly longer answer is: Since you already use xterm, which uses the
X server, why not go one step furter and use gvim? You would then have
all the scrollbars you would want (even vertical scrollbars on both
sides of the only window, if that's what you want).

I thought a little bit about the possibility of a "scrollbar", or a
visual representation of a position in the file. Maybe there's a way to
put it in the statusline. Right now, I have this as my statusline:
set statusline=%f\ [%{(&fenc==\"\"?&enc:&fenc).((exists(\"+bomb\")\ &&\
&bomb)?\",B\":\"\")}%M%R%H%W]\ %y\ [%l/%L,%v]\ [%p%%]
That evaluates to something like this:
.vimrc [utf-8] [vim] [41/382,23] [10%]
Now, maybe there's a way to have something more visual instead of the
last block, which shows the percentage. What would be great if the whole
status bar could extend over the entire available width, and show
something like a progressbar, so that it looks like this:
.vimrc [utf-8] [vim] [41/382,23] [----o--------------------------------]
The 'o' would move proportionally with the position in the file. Just an
idea.
Right now, I'm not sure if/how this could be implemented. The element
would have to know it's own width, and the width of the current terminal
window. Maybe someone has some ideas about this?

It's easier to take a wild guess at how much place will be there for the
scrollbar.
Otherwise the length of the other fields have to be computed.
"-----------%<-----------------
func! STL()
let stl = '%f [%{(&fenc==""?&enc:&fenc).((exists("+bomb") &&
&bomb)?",B":"")}%M%R%H%W] %y [%l/%L,%v] [%p%%]'
let barWidth = &columns - 65 " <-- wild guess
let barWidth = barWidth < 3 ? 3 : barWidth
if line('$') > 1
let progress = (line('.')-1) * (barWidth-1) / (line('$')-1)
else
let progress = barWidth/2
endif
" line + vcol + %
let pad = strlen(line('$'))-strlen(line('.')) + 3 -
strlen(virtcol('.')) + 3 - strlen(line('.')*100/line('$'))
let bar = repeat(' ',pad).' [%1*%'.barWidth.'.'.barWidth.'('
\.repeat('-',progress )
\.'%2*0%1*'
\.repeat('-',barWidth - progress - 1).'%0*%)%<]'
return stl.bar
endfun
hi def link User1 DiffAdd
hi def link User2 DiffDelete
set stl=%!STL()
"-----------%<-----------------

From special codes in the 'statusline' option value, which it gets from
the complex "let bar = bla bla bla" above:
%1* use User1 from now on
%2* use User2 from now on
%0* go back to StatusLine (or StatusLineNC)
see ":help 'statusline'".
